Transformation (The Butterfly)



Steps, weary and old
Stories to be told, the times shall soon unfold
stairs, so desolate, so many stories untold
Fly beyond the mountain,
over the valley, beneath the sun,
many have chosen,
to travel far and young.

The memories behold, as thy truth unfold
the years go by, many were brisk and cold.
Times have changed, yet so have I,
They watch as she flies away,
She is I.
I am a butterfly.

About this poem

This is essentially about a butterfly who is making its transformation. I am the butterfly. This also tells the story about an older man, or woman, who has many stories to be told... and the steps represent the stories, and the older person.
